Amar Hromo – Architect

Residing in Doha, Qatar, Amar is an accomplished architect with a global portfolio. Born in Sarajevo, Bosnia and Herzegovina, he earned his master’s degree in architecture and urban planning from the University of Sarajevo. With extensive experience on large-scale international projects including stadiums, commercial, leisure, mixed-use, healthcare, educational and high-rise buildings, Amar has a reputation for excellence and innovation.

Throughout his career, Amar has worked on high-end projects across the Middle East, including large-scale projects in Qatar, Dubai, Abu Dhabi, KSA and Kuwait. His work spans the entire region, showcasing his ability to manage and deliver complex architectural designs for governmental and private sector clients.

As a Senior Architectural Designer at KEO International Consultants, Amar is dedicated to shaping the built environment with creativity and precision. He is a proud member of the American Institute of Architects (AIA), actively contributing to their International Communication and Public Relations Committee. His dedication to promoting cultural heritage was recognized during his tenure as an Honorary Cultural Ambassador for Qatar Museums.
